(According to Lexico, powered by Oxford Dictionary) https://www.lexico.com/en/definition/latino
Latino: (in North America) a person of Latin American origin or descent, especially a man or boy.

(According to dictionary.com) https://www.dictionary.com/browse/latino?s=t
Latino: a person of Latin American origin or descent, especially one living in the United States.

(According to Cambridge Dictionary) https://dictionary.cambridge.org/us/dictionary/english/latino?q=Latino
Latino: a person who lives in the U.S. and who comes from, or whose family comes from, Latin America.
